I love how kids like this think these checkpoints have never been adjudicated by the SCOUS and their constitutionality established.

http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Michigan_Dept._of_State_Police_v._Sitz

By a 6-3 decision the court held that these stops are "reasonable search and seizure" and that brief questioning to establish suspicion or lack thereof was permissible.
